The NOVUS NV10 is the first digital instrument to incorporate Kawai’s leading acoustic grand piano keyboard action technology, renowned for the pioneering use of extended spruce key sticks and innovative ABS Carbon components that are stronger, lighter, and more dimensionally stable than conventional wooden parts.
The specially adapted Millennium III Hybrid keyboard action utilised by the NV10 replaces traditional felt hammers with modern ABS equivalents that are individual graded in weight from bass to treble, while high-precision optical sensors take the place of metal strings, accurately reading the subtle movements of each hammer as the corresponding keys are played.
In addition to featuring a full acoustic grand piano keyboard action, the NOVUS NV10 is the first hybrid instrument to also incorporate a real grand piano damper mechanism. While there are no strings inside the NV10 to require physical damping, this unique feature replicates the true weighting of a grand piano damper pedal, while also mechanically easing the keyboard action’s touch weight as the pedal is pressed – an important acoustic piano characteristic that, until now, has been overlooked.
Shigeru Kawai SK-EX concert grand piano reproduced with new SK-EX Rendering sound technology
The magnificent tone of Kawai’s flagship Shigeru Kawai SK-EX full concert grand piano is at the heart of the NOVUS NV10 hybrid digital piano. Widely regarded as the ‘premier pianos of Japan’, Shigeru Kawai instruments grace the stages of concert halls and musical institutions throughout the world, and are prized for their tonal clarity and exceptional dynamic range.
In order to faithfully reproduce the stunning sound of a Shigeru digitally, Kawai has developed SK-EX Rendering – a brand new piano sound engine that blends multi-channel, 88-key sampling with the latest resonance modelling technology. Multi-channel sampling captures the sound from different points of the Shigeru Kawai concert grand piano, allowing a broader range of tonal characteristics to be reproduced, and providing a more lively, authentic response to changes in dynamics. This naturally expressive sound is further enriched by newly developed resonance algorithms, which physically model the complex tonal interactions produced by the strings, dampers, and various other parts of an acoustic piano, giving players the impression that they’re sitting at a living, breathing instrument.
Developed in collaboration with Onkyo, one of Japan’s leading premium audio equipment manufacturers, the NOVUS NV10 hybrid digital piano is one of the first Kawai musical instruments to utilise specialist components designed for high-end audio reproduction. With state of the art technologies such as 1-bit DSD processing, dual DAC signal conversion, and Onkyo’s exclusive DIDRC circuitry, the NOVUS’ optimised power amplifiers reproduce the Shigeru Kawai grand piano sound with stunning richness and clarity.
This high fidelity sound is delivered using a custom 7-speaker output system, designed to reproduced the three dimensional sound field of an acoustic grand piano. Lower-range bass frequencies are transmitted with power and precision from the underside of the NOVUS via a large woofer, while higher frequencies are projected outward using four top-facing speakers. These mid-range units are calibrated to expand the depth of sound beyond the instrument, thus recreating the length of a grand piano, while still providing a feeling of proximity and presence for the player. Finally, two dome tweeters placed behind the upper board ensure crisp, clear treble frequencies, allowing the authentic resonances generated by the SK-EX Rendering sound engine to sparkle and shimmer like an acoustic instrument.
The NOVUS NV10 hybrid digital piano also incorporate Onkyo’s brand new high-performance Discrete SpectraModule™ headphone amplifier, which combines with Kawai’s Spatial Headphone Sound (SHS) technology to guarantee the finest quality and most engaging listening experience, even when playing in privacy.
In addition to standard USB and MIDI jacks for connecting to computers or other instruments, the NOVUS NV10 hybrid digital piano also features integrated Bluetooth® MIDI and Audio technology that allows the instrument to communicate with supported smart devices wirelessly. Once paired to a phone, tablet, or laptop, NOVUS owners can enjoy a wide variety of exciting music-related apps that enhance their learning and playing experience, or stream audio from songs and videos directly through the instrument’s premium amplifier and speaker system without the need to connect any cables.
The NOVUS NV10 hybrid digital piano is the first instrument of its kind to feature a full-colour 5″ touchscreen display. Discreetly embedded within the left cheekblock, this high resolution touchscreen allows sounds and settings to be selected from an attractive user interface simply by tapping or swiping the display with a finger. The screen can also be set to turn off automatically while playing, thus preserving the instrument’s acoustic piano-like appearance, and minimising any visual distraction to the performer.
